Fall patterns and what to throw In early fall, water temps in the Ankara area hover in the mid-60s F (around 15–18 C). That cooling shift nudges bass to key structure and feeding windows around first light and again in the late afternoon. A practical approach:
-
Start shallow along weedlines and rocky points with a light topwater or a spinnerbait to provoke reaction bites as the sun rises.
-
When the wind comes up (even a light breeze helps), probe weed edges and creek mouths with a lipless crank or a small swimbait in 6–12 ft of water.
-
For pressured or finicky fish, switch to a drop-shot or a finesse worm around docks and submerged cover.

Weather tip and seasonal wrap-up Weather in early fall around Ankara is typically mild, with partly cloudy days like today, around the low to mid-60s F and light winds. That combination favors shallow-to-mid pattern fishing in the morning and again late afternoon as waters warm a touch. If you see a clear, sunny window, push the topwater and spinnerbait along edges; when clouds roll in or the wind picks up, switch to a lipless crank or drop-shot at 6–12 ft. Seasonal weather summary: warm mornings turning cooler by afternoon, consistent light winds, and moderate humidity create stable feeding windows—great for scouting weedlines and creek mouths near Lake Mogan and Eymir Gölü.
Practical tip: start with a small white spinnerbait or a 1/2 oz lipless crank and fan cast along weed edges and points during dawn; if bites lag, slow your presentation and work a drop-shot around any docks or submerged cover.
